I'd like to be able to refer to a Named Range on another
workbook, let's call it Employees.xls, from a second
workbook, something like this.
=VLOOKUP(A3,Employees.xls!nEmployeeTable,2,FALSE)
Works a treat but only when the Employees workbook is
open. Is there a way around this or is it a 'feature'?
